OCI Developer / Integration Engineer
Job Fit Check
Base Career helps you apply smarter for this job.
Key skills for this role
About the Role
Must Have 3–6 years of experience in integration development, ideally with Oracle Integration Cloud (OIC). Demonstrated hands-on experience designing and deploying solutions on Oracle Cloud Infrastructure (OCI).
Key Skills for This Role
Full Job Posting
Must Have
- 3–6 years of experience in integration development, ideally with Oracle Integration Cloud (OIC).
- Demonstrated hands-on experience designing and deploying solutions on Oracle Cloud Infrastructure (OCI).
- Strong command of integration patterns, REST and SOAP web services, and data mapping and transformation.
- Production experience implementing robust error handling, fault management, and monitoring across integration flows.
- A methodical, detail-oriented approach to building reliable integrations.
- Nice to Have
- Experience integrating Oracle SaaS applications such as ERP Cloud and HCM Cloud.
- Familiarity with Visual Builder (VBCS), Oracle SOA Suite, or other Oracle PaaS services.
- Knowledge of message queues and event-driven integration patterns.
- Experience with file-based integrations (SFTP) and B2B integrations.
- Exposure to CI/CD and automated deployment for integrations.
- Oracle ecosystem experience in an enterprise or government environment.
- Oracle certifications (OCI, OIC).
Responsibilities
- Design, build, and maintain integrations using Oracle Integration Cloud (OIC), including integration flows, adapters, and connections.
- Develop, configure, and deploy solutions on Oracle Cloud Infrastructure (OCI).
- Integrate enterprise systems (ERP, HCM, and custom applications) through REST and SOAP web services.
- Implement data mapping, transformation, and orchestration between source and target systems.
- Build, expose, and consume APIs, and design integration interfaces.
- Implement robust error handling, retries, logging, and fault management in integration flows.
- Monitor, troubleshoot, and optimize integration flows and resolve production issues.
- Write and maintain PL/SQL and work with Oracle databases for data access and transformation.
- Document integration designs, mappings, and interface specifications.
- Collaborate with functional consultants and application teams to gather and refine integration requirements.
- Participate in testing, including unit, system integration, and user acceptance testing of integrations.
- Support deployment, environment migration, and post go-live maintenance of integrations.
Qualifications
- Bachelor's degree in Computer Science, Information Systems, Software Engineering, or a related field; equivalent experience accepted.
- Hands-on experience developing and deploying on Oracle Cloud Infrastructure (OCI).
- Strong knowledge of integration patterns, REST and SOAP web services, and API design.
- Experience with data mapping, transformation (e.g., XSLT or JSON), and orchestration.
- Proficiency in PL/SQL and experience working with Oracle databases.
- Experience with error handling, fault management, and monitoring of integrations.
- Understanding of authentication and security in integration scenarios (e.g., OAuth, certificates).
- Ability to gather requirements and work with functional and technical teams.
Apply for this job in 1 click
Skip the repetitive application forms
Install the Base Career Chrome Extension and autofill job applications across major job boards with your profile.
Trusted by over 500,000 job seekers on Base Career
More from this employer
More jobs at malomatia
Scrum Lead
Doha, QAT
Job Description Must Have 5+ years of delivery experience, of which 4+ as Scrum Master / Squad Lead Proven track record leading mixed squads (frontend + backend + data + QA) to release in a government context. Demonst
Senior Solution Architect
Doha, QAT
Job Description Partner with sales and pre-sales teams to understand client requirements and translate them into technical solutions. Responsibilities Partner with sales and pre-sales teams to understand client requirem
Business Analyst
Doha, QAT
Job Description Must Have 3+ years of business analysis experience on enterprise digital transformation, data, or AI programs. Proven experience working inside agile squads as the BA counterpart to a Product Owner. De
Software Engineer
Doha, QAT
Job Description Must Have 3–6 years of full-stack software development experience. Hands-on proficiency across a modern frontend framework (React or Angular) and a server-side stack (Node.js, Java, or Python) with REST
Senior Data Scientist
Doha, QAT
Job Description Must Have 6–10 years of experience in data science, analytics, or applied statistics, including a demonstrable track record of leading projects end to end. Senior technical voice on a data science team
Data Scientist
Doha, QAT
Job Description Must Have 3–5 years of experience in data science, analytics, or a quantitative modeling role. Hands-on proficiency in Python (pandas, NumPy, scikit-learn) and SQL for building and evaluating models end
DataOps Specialist
Doha, QAT
Job Description Required Skills & Competencies Hands-on experience operating data pipelines, data workflows, data jobs, ETL/ELT processes, or analytics platform workloads Practical experience with data orchestration and
Application Delivery Manager
Doha, QAT
The Delivery Unit Leader for Application Development is responsible for overseeing the end-to-end execution of the Software Development Life Cycle (SDLC) for Malomatia’s custom application development portfolio. This rol
Scrum Lead
Doha, QAT
Senior Solution Architect
Doha, QAT
Business Analyst
Doha, QAT
Software Engineer
Doha, QAT
Senior Data Scientist
Doha, QAT
Data Scientist
Doha, QAT
DataOps Specialist
Doha, QAT
Application Delivery Manager
Doha, QAT